Patrick names transportation secretary

Amicus posted it here on BMG before anyone else had it anywhere that I know of — good sources there, pal!  Bernard Cohen, currently directing the Federal Transit Administration’s efforts to rebuild transportation facilities in lower Manhattan that were damaged in the Sept. 11 attacks, will be the state’s new Secretary of Transportation. Very, very good call to go outside of Big Dig land for this job, IMHO.  Beyond that, I know nothing about Mr. Cohen.  Anyone?

Ben LaGuer OPEN THREAD

As many of you know Ben LaGuer’s case is going to oral arguments in the SJC on January 4. For 23 years he has been claiming his innocence of a vicious rape. I have been posting to BMG about the case since last June. The case and the current round of appeals raise many many issues which I plan to get into here on BMG in the next two weeks.
